Employee Benefits in Mergers and Acquisitions (Hardcover)


Employee Benefits in Mergers and Acquisitions is an essential tool in assisting both the benefits and M&A professional in handling these complicated issues. This is the first book to fully examine every major employee benefits concern likely to arise in the wake of a merger or acquisition. Includes legal and tax compliance issues, strategies to avoid costly litigation and the soundest business practices for administering benefits and compensation plans in a merger and acquisition setting. Corporate mergers and buyout transactions continue to occur in high numbers. These transactions affect large and small companies alike, and each merger or acquisition creates a wide range of legal and tax implications. The most important concerns are employee compensation and benefits issues, which are frequently overlooked in the midst of a merger or acquisition. Employee Benefits in Mergers and Acquisitions provides expert guidance on how to deal with these issues.
